The reportsidentify contaminants in talc and finished powder products as asbestosor describe them in terms typically applied to asbestos,such as fiberform and rods., In 1976, as the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) was weighing limits on asbestos in cosmetictalc products, J&J assured the regulatorthat no asbestos was detected in any sample of talc produced between December 1972 and October 1973. The attached letters demonstrate responsibility of industry in monitoring its talcs, the cover lettersaid. Its researchers had strapped an air sampling device to a doll to take measurements while it was powdered, according to J&J memos and the minutesof a Feb. 19, 1974, meeting of the Cosmetic Toiletry and Fragrance Association (CTFA), an industry group. That assertion, backed by decades of solid science showing that asbestos causes mesothelioma and is associated with ovarian and other cancers, has had mixed success in court. Its also partly why regulations that protect people in mines, mills, factories and schools from asbestos-laden talc dont apply to babies and others exposed to cosmetic talc even though Baby Powder talc has at times come from the same mines as talc sold for industrial use. An early test, for example, was incapable of detecting chrysotile fibers, as an FDA official recognized in a J&J account of an Aug. 11, 1972, meeting with the agency: I understand that some samples will be passed even though they contain such fibers, but we are willing to live with it..
